Z84.1 Family history of disorders of kidney and ureter

Summary

This ICD code is used to document an individual's family history of conditions affecting the kidney or ureter. It indicates a potential genetic or hereditary risk for similar disorders, though it does not represent a current diagnosis in the individual.

Causes

Genetic predisposition is the primary cause recognized by this code, reflecting the hereditary nature of many kidney and ureter conditions that may run in families.

Risk Factors

  • Having one or more first-degree relatives (parents, siblings, children) with kidney or ureter disorders.
  • Family-related genetic mutations or hereditary patterns that increase susceptibility to these conditions.

Symptoms

This code does not refer to symptoms of a current condition in the individual but highlights potential risks based on family history.

Diagnosis

Collected through family medical history assessments and genetic counseling as needed. Physicians may suggest screenings based on the specific conditions present in the family history.

Treatment Options

This ICD code itself does not necessitate treatment but may prompt preventive measures or regular monitoring based on identified risks.

Prognosis and Follow-Up

Prognosis depends on the specific conditions in the family history and the individual's overall health. Regular follow-up may be recommended to monitor for early signs of kidney or ureter disorders.

Complications

Complications are not directly associated with this code but may arise if the individual develops a related condition due to genetic risk.

Lifestyle & Prevention

Maintaining a healthy lifestyle, including adequate hydration and avoiding nephrotoxic substances, may help reduce risk. Regular check-ups can aid in early detection.

When to Seek Professional Help

Consult a healthcare provider if symptoms of kidney or ureter issues appear, such as pain, changes in urination, or swelling, especially with a known family history.

Tips for Medical Coders

Use this code to document a family history of kidney or ureter disorders. Ensure documentation supports the genetic or hereditary risk and does not confuse it with a current diagnosis.
